5-(Difluoromethyl)pyrazine-2-carboxilic acid, which is a raw material for the construction of 5- (difluoromethyl)pyrazine-2-carboxamide, which is a common partial structural motif of the compound having an A production in hibitory action or a BACE1 inhibitory action, can be industrially advantageously produced by decarboxylating 5- [carboxy(difluoro)methyl]pyrazine-2-carboxylic acid, which is obtainable from 5-chloropyrazine-2-carboxylate. |
